Comprehending the UK Driving Licence System
The UK driving licence system is designed to guarantee that all drivers on the road have actually shown the necessary knowledge, skills, and proficiency to run a vehicle safely. The Driver and Vehicle Licensing Agency (DVLA) is the governing body responsible for providing driving licences in Great Britain, while the Driver and Vehicle Agency (DVA) deals with matters in Northern Ireland.
A full UK driving licence permits holders to drive motor automobiles on public roads, supplied they fulfill the legal requirements and abide by roadway traffic guidelines. The licence contains important information including categories of automobiles the holder is allowed to drive, any constraints or recommendations, and the licence's expiration date.

Theory Test Requirements
When you hold your provisionary licence, the next step involves passing the theory test. This examination consists of 2 parts: multiple-choice concerns and a threat understanding test. The multiple-choice section covers subjects such as road signs, traffic policies, safe driving practices, and basic roadway safety understanding. The risk perception test examines your ability to recognize and react to establishing threats while driving.

Practical Driving Training
After passing your theory test, you can begin practical driving lessons with a qualified driving trainer or an authorized driving trainer (ADI). The variety of lessons required varies substantially between individuals-- some may need just 20 to 30 hours while others might need 40 hours or more to reach the necessary standard for the dry run.
Throughout your useful training, you'll find out important skills consisting of car control, road positioning, risk anticipation, and safe decision-making. Your trainer will assist you through gradually challenging driving circumstances, building your confidence and competence on the roadway.
The Practical Driving Test
The useful driving test assesses your ability to drive safely in various road and traffic conditions. The test normally lasts about 40 minutes for car tests and consists of an eyesight check, safety questions about the vehicle, driving ability evaluation, and possibly reversing maneuvers.
The inspector will examine your total driving proficiency including your capability to operate the automobile safely, your understanding of traffic signs and road markings, your interaction with other road users, and your ability to drive individually for a short period. Upon passing the dry run, you'll get your complete driving licence, though the examiner may supply a pass certificate while the main licence is processed by the DVLA.

Important Considerations and RequirementsMedical Fitness
All licence applicants must fulfill certain medical standards. The DVLA requires candidates to state any medical conditions that might impact their ability to drive safely. Conditions such as epilepsy, diabetes, particular heart disease, and visual impairments may require extra paperwork or assessment before a licence can be given.
Age Restrictions
Various licence categories have various minimum age requirements. Category B (automobiles) requires the applicant to be a minimum of 17 years old, while Category AM (mopeds) can be obtained from age 16. For bigger lorries and motorcycles, age requirements vary based upon the particular category.
Photocard Licence Renewal
UK driving licences are now provided as photocard licences that need renewal every 10 years. You'll require to upgrade your photograph and signature when renewing, guaranteeing your licence remains current and precisely represents your identity.

What takes place if I fail my driving test?
If you fail your theory or dry run, you can retake it after a specified waiting duration-- at least 3 working days for the theory test and a minimum of 10 working days for the dry run. There's no limit on how lots of times you can retake the tests, though each effort sustains additional charges. Many driving trainers recommend extra practice focusing on areas where the examiner kept in mind weak points.
